Carbondale trustees approve consent agenda, authorize DOLA grant application for Roaring Fork treatment plant upgrade
Summary
The board unanimously approved the consent agenda, which includes seeking Department of Local Affairs funding to expand the Roaring Fork water treatment plant’s clear well and add filters to reduce chlorine use and create full system backup.
Carbondale’s Board of Trustees voted unanimously to approve its consent agenda, including authorization to pursue a Department of Local Affairs (DOLA) resiliency grant for the Roaring Fork Treatment Plant expansion.
